Frequently Asked Questions For Cooling Towels for Hiking

A cooling towel is a specially designed fabric that helps regulate body temperature by providing a cooling effect when wet. When soaked in water, these towels can absorb heat from the skin and evaporate moisture, creating a refreshing sensation. This makes them particularly useful during hiking, as they can help you stay comfortable and prevent overheating in warm weather.

Cooling towels are typically made from lightweight, breathable materials such as microfiber or polyester blends. These fabrics are designed to wick moisture away from the skin and enhance evaporation, which contributes to the cooling effect. Additionally, many cooling towels are treated with special technologies to improve their performance and durability.

To use a cooling towel effectively while hiking, first soak it in water until it is fully saturated. Wring out any excess water and then drape it around your neck, over your shoulders, or on your forehead. You can re-soak the towel as needed to maintain its cooling effect, making it a practical accessory for long hikes in hot conditions.

Cooling towels are most effective in warm or hot weather, where they can help lower body temperature and provide relief from heat. However, in cooler conditions, they may not be as beneficial, as the cooling effect might be uncomfortable. It's important to assess the weather and your personal comfort levels when deciding to use a cooling towel on your hike.

When selecting a cooling towel for hiking, consider factors such as size, material, and ease of use. A larger towel may provide more coverage, while lightweight and compact options are easier to carry. Additionally, look for towels that offer quick-drying properties and are easy to clean, ensuring they remain effective and hygienic during your outdoor adventures.
